The Role of Community Oversight
The blockchain industry has developed unique accountability mechanisms through community oversight. Independent investigators who analyse on-chain data provide a form of distributed audit function that traditional industries typically handle through formal regulatory oversight or internal compliance teams.
This community-driven accountability model offers several advantages: it operates continuously rather than periodically, leverages diverse expertise from across the global community, and provides public transparency that traditional audit processes often lack. However, it also creates challenges for projects that must navigate constant public scrutiny while building sustainable business models.
Building Robust Blockchain Governance
For blockchain projects seeking enterprise adoption, establishing credible governance frameworks becomes essential. This requires implementing several key components:
Clear token distribution policies that explain allocation rationales and prevent conflicts of interest represent a fundamental starting point. Projects must articulate why tokens are distributed in specific ways and ensure that insider advantages do not undermine broader ecosystem health.
Transparent valuation methodologies help stakeholders understand project economics and assess investment risks appropriately. When valuations appear disconnected from underlying fundamentals, it raises questions about market manipulation or unrealistic expectations.
Regular reporting mechanisms that provide ongoing visibility into project operations, financial health, and strategic decisions help build stakeholder confidence. This goes beyond technical updates to include business metrics and governance decisions that affect token holders and ecosystem participants.
